      <description>I'm running command line collector on 64 bit linux system.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;My results are as follows:&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;amplxe-cl -collect hotspots -r /tmp/results /bin/ls&lt;BR /&gt;Error: Can't start application&lt;BR /&gt;Using result path `/tmp/results'&lt;BR /&gt;Executing actions 50 % done &lt;BR /&gt;Error: Error 0x4000001d (Cannot find raw collector data) -- Cannot re-finalize the result: it has no raw collector data.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;I haven't been able to find documentation for reasons why I would get this "Can't start application" message. The actual application I use doesn't make a difference. &l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;Does anybody have any insight into why I would get this message?&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;It seems that Ican't reproduceit on my side.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;[peter@NHM02 ~]$ vi /etc/group&lt;BR /&gt;I think that you installed the product with "root" user, and use amplxe-clafter log-on other user. Are you sure that your useraccount in "vtune" group?&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;[peter@NHM02 ~]$ source /opt/intel/vtune_amplifier_xe_2011/amplxe-vars.sh&lt;BR /&gt;Copyright (C) 2009-2011 Intel Corporation. All rights reserved.&lt;BR /&gt;Intel VTune Amplifier XE 2011 (build 150226)&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;[peter@NHM02 ~]$ amplxe-cl -collect hotspots -r /tmp/results /bin/ls&lt;BR /&gt;...&lt;BR /&gt;Using result path `/tmp/results'&lt;BR /&gt;Executing actions 75 % Generating a report&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Summary&lt;BR /&gt;-------&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Elapsed Time: 0.002&lt;BR /&gt;CPU Time: 0&lt;BR /&gt;Executing actions 100 % done&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;Regards, Peter&lt;/P&gt;</description>
